The apartment unit below mine has complained of water marks on the slab soffit and Form 28 was served. There are no sign of wetness on my timber floor and at my kitchen cabinet above the wet spots at the slab soffit of the unit below. Based on the advice of all contractors and architects I consulted, fixing of the leakage should be approached from the bottom i.e. the slab soffit of the unit below, since no sign of leakage can be detected from my unit. Exact spot of leakage also cannot be determined and it is suspected to be a concealed pipe within the slab closer to the bottom or at the middle of the slab.

The owner of the unit below has, however, denied access for fixing of the leak via the wet spots at the unit's slab soffit, while expecting the leakage to be fixed nonetheless. What are my rights and recourse as the owner above this unit with wet spots, who is responsible to fix the leakage but is not permitted to access the unit below?
